Meal Ideas for Boosting Adrenal Function
Breakfast options rich in nutrients. Lunch and dinner recipes to support adrenal health. Snacks that provide energy and balance hormones.Start your day with a nutrient-rich breakfast. Try oatmeal topped with nuts and berries. This meal is full of fiber and antioxidants. For lunch, enjoy a quinoa salad with greens and grilled chicken. It fuels your body and helps your adrenal glands. Dinner can include salmon with sweet potatoes and steamed veggies. This combination is packed with healthy fats and vitamins.
Snacks can make a big difference too! Choose energy-boosting options like trail mix or apple slices with nut butter.
- Breakfast: Oatmeal with nuts and berries
- Lunch: Quinoa salad with chicken
- Dinner: Salmon and sweet potatoes
- Snacks: Trail mix or apple slices
